在当今数据驱动的商业环境中,企业越来越依赖于数据分析来优化运营、提升效率并做出更明智的决策。指标预测分析作为一种重要的数据分析方法,能够帮助企业提前预知关键业务指标的变化趋势,从而在竞争激烈的市场中占据优势。而LSTM(长短期记忆网络)作为一种强大的深度学习模型,正在成为实现精准时序预测的核心工具。本文将深入探讨指标预测分析的重要性、LSTM模型的工作原理以及其在实际应用中的优势。
什么是指标预测分析?
指标预测分析是指通过对历史数据的建模和分析,预测未来某一特定指标的变化趋势。这些指标可以是销售额、用户活跃度、设备运行状态等,广泛应用于金融、制造、零售、能源等多个行业。
为什么指标预测分析对企业至关重要?
- 优化资源配置:通过预测未来的需求或趋势,企业可以更合理地分配资源,例如调整生产计划或优化库存管理。
- 提升决策效率:实时或短期预测可以帮助企业在关键时刻快速做出决策,避免因信息滞后而导致的损失。
- 风险预警:预测分析能够提前识别潜在的风险或异常情况,例如销售下滑或设备故障,从而采取预防措施。
- 驱动创新:通过对历史数据的深入分析,企业可以发现隐藏的模式和趋势,为产品创新和业务拓展提供数据支持。
LSTM模型:实现精准时序预测的核心技术
LSTM(Long Short-Term Memory)是一种特殊的循环神经网络(RNN),专为解决传统RNN在处理长序列数据时的梯度消失或梯度爆炸问题而设计。LSTM通过引入“细胞状态”和“门控机制”,能够有效捕捉时间序列数据中的长期依赖关系,从而在时序预测任务中表现出色。
LSTM模型的工作原理
- 细胞状态(Cell State):LSTM的核心是细胞状态,它类似于数据的“记忆”,能够传递长期信息。
- 门控机制(Gate Mechanism):LSTM通过两个门控(输入门和遗忘门)来控制信息的流动:
- 输入门:决定当前时刻输入数据中有多少信息会被写入细胞状态。
- 遗忘门:决定细胞状态中的哪些信息需要被遗忘或保留。
- 输出门:根据细胞状态和输入数据,生成最终的输出结果。
LSTM模型的优势
- 捕捉长期依赖:LSTM能够有效处理时间序列数据中的长距离依赖关系,这对于许多实际应用(如股票价格预测、设备故障预测)至关重要。
- 鲁棒性高:LSTM对噪声数据具有较强的鲁棒性,能够在数据质量较低的情况下仍保持较好的预测性能。
- 可解释性:虽然LSTM的内部机制较为复杂,但其门控机制为企业提供了对模型决策过程的一定解释能力。
指标预测分析中的LSTM模型应用
LSTM模型在指标预测分析中的应用非常广泛,以下是几个典型场景:
1. 数据中台的实时监控与预测
数据中台是企业实现数据资产化和数据服务化的关键平台。通过将LSTM模型集成到数据中台,企业可以实时监控关键业务指标(如用户活跃度、订单量)的变化趋势,并对未来可能出现的异常情况进行预警。
- 应用场景:实时监控、异常检测、短期预测。
- 优势:LSTM模型能够快速适应数据的变化,确保预测结果的实时性和准确性。
2. 数字孪生中的实时预测
数字孪生是一种通过数字模型实时反映物理世界状态的技术,广泛应用于智能制造、智慧城市等领域。LSTM模型在数字孪生中的应用主要体现在对物理设备或系统的运行状态进行实时预测。
- 应用场景:设备故障预测、能源消耗预测、交通流量预测。
- 优势:LSTM模型能够处理高维、多模态的时间序列数据,为数字孪生提供更精准的预测结果。
3. 数字可视化中的动态预测
数字可视化是将数据转化为直观的图表或图形的过程,广泛应用于企业报表、指挥中心等领域。通过结合LSTM模型,数字可视化系统可以实现动态预测功能,帮助用户更直观地理解数据变化趋势。
- 应用场景:销售预测、用户行为预测、市场趋势预测。
- 优势:LSTM模型能够提供高精度的预测结果,结合数字可视化技术,为企业决策提供更强大的支持。
LSTM模型与其他时序预测模型的对比
在指标预测分析中,LSTM模型并不是唯一的选择,但其在许多场景下表现出了显著的优势。以下是LSTM模型与其他常见时序预测模型的对比:
1. ARIMA(自回归积分滑动平均模型)
- 优点:适合处理线性时间序列数据,模型简单易实现。
- 缺点:难以处理非线性数据和长距离依赖关系。
- 适用场景:适用于简单的时间序列预测任务。
2. Prophet(Facebook开源的时序预测工具)
- 优点:易于使用,适合处理含有噪声的时间序列数据。
- 缺点:对复杂的非线性关系处理能力有限。
- 适用场景:适用于中短期预测任务。
3. 传统机器学习模型(如随机森林、支持向量机)
- 优点:适合处理非时间序列数据,模型解释性强。
- 缺点:难以捕捉时间序列数据中的长期依赖关系。
- 适用场景:适用于非时间序列数据的预测任务。
4. LSTM模型
- 优点:能够捕捉时间序列数据中的长期依赖关系,适合处理复杂、非线性的时间序列数据。
- 缺点:模型复杂度较高,训练时间较长。
- 适用场景:适用于复杂的时间序列预测任务,如股票价格预测、设备故障预测。
如何选择适合的指标预测分析模型?
在选择指标预测分析模型时,企业需要综合考虑以下几个因素:
- 数据特性:如果数据中包含明显的长期依赖关系,LSTM模型可能是更好的选择;如果数据较为简单,可以考虑使用ARIMA或Prophet。
- 预测精度:如果对预测精度要求较高,LSTM模型通常能够提供更准确的结果。
- 计算资源:LSTM模型的训练需要较高的计算资源,企业需要根据自身条件选择合适的模型。
- 业务需求:如果业务需求涉及复杂的非线性关系,LSTM模型可能是更合适的选择。
未来发展趋势
随着人工智能技术的不断发展,指标预测分析和LSTM模型的应用前景将更加广阔。以下是未来可能的发展趋势:
- 模型优化:通过改进LSTM模型的结构(如引入更深的网络层或更复杂的门控机制),进一步提升预测精度。
- 多模态数据融合:将LSTM模型与其他数据源(如图像、文本)相结合,实现更全面的预测分析。
- 边缘计算:将LSTM模型部署到边缘设备,实现更快速、更实时的预测分析。
- 自动化预测:通过自动化工具(如自动特征工程、自动超参数调优)简化LSTM模型的训练和部署过程。
结语
指标预测分析是企业实现数据驱动决策的核心能力之一,而LSTM模型作为一种强大的深度学习工具,正在为这一能力的实现提供强有力的支持。通过将LSTM模型应用于数据中台、数字孪生和数字可视化等领域,企业可以更精准地预测未来趋势,从而在激烈的市场竞争中占据优势。
如果您对LSTM模型或指标预测分析感兴趣,可以申请试用相关工具:申请试用。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。